Overview
Vrije Universiteit Brussel's (VUB) Master of Science in Biomedical Research spans two academic years. In the first semester, you’ll follow a number of compulsory courses (e.g. academic English for life sciences, laboratory animal sciences and biostatistics, bio-ethics).These will arm you with the necessary scientific skills and ethical awareness to perform as a professional internationally-orientated researcher. In the second semester, it’s time to start writing a review paper on the research topic of your second internship and you’ll complete a short laboratory internship.
The strenghts of the Biomedical Research master's programme
- A highly practical programme focused on academic scientific research training, along with education in small groups.
- The VUB Health Campus has an excellent reputation in innovative biomedical research demonstrated by the presence of 10 research clusters.
- A very thorough hands-on training thanks to two internships, and proven in a master's thesis.

Other requirements
General requirements
For other academic bachelors, including medicine, pharmaceutical sciences, biochemistry, biotechnology, bio-engineering, biology and life sciences, equivalency will be evaluated based on scientific competences and practical skills of the students by our Steering Committee on Internationalization. At least a sufficient level of education (≥ 5 ECTS) in Biochemistry, Molecular and Cellular Biology, Microbiology, Immunology, Genetics, Pharmacology, Biostatistics, Physiology and Pathology are required.
In addition to certified copies of diplomas, your CV, a motivational letter and two recommendation letters are required. The Steering Committee may also contact you by video conference to assess your qualifications and discuss your expectations of the master programme.
All applicants must provide evidence of proficiency in English. Prospective students can provide proof of sufficient knowledge of English as the language of instruction
